| Criterion | Bose QuietComfort Headphones | Bowers & Wilkins Px8 Over-Ear Wireless Noise Cancelling Headphones |
|---|---|---|
| Rating | ★4.6(17,542)Amazon | ★4.6(256)Amazon |
Form Factor | Over-ear | Over-ear (Closed-back) |
Connectivity | Bluetooth, 2.5mm to 3.5mm analog cable | Bluetooth 5.2; USB-C Audio (Hi-Res 24-bit); 3.5 mm Analog (via included USB-C cable) |
Bluetooth Version | Bluetooth 5.1 | 5.2 |
Codecs | SBC, AAC | aptX Adaptive, aptX HD, aptX, AAC, SBC |
ANC | Yes (Quiet & Aware modes + Custom modes) | Yes (Hybrid Noise Cancellation with 4 mics) |
Transparency | Yes (Aware Mode) | Yes (Ambient Pass-Through) |
Drivers | Custom dynamic drivers (Size/Type undisclosed by manufacturer) | 2 × 40 mm Carbon Cone dynamic drivers |
Frequency Response | 20 Hz - 20 kHz (Measured) | N/A (Manufacturer does not publish) |
Microphones | Microphone system with noise-rejecting boomless array | 6 total (4 for ANC, 2 for telephony with CVC technology) |
Battery Life | Up to 24 hrs | Up to 30 hours |
Battery Life | N/A (Headphones only) | N/A (Headphones only) |
Charging | USB-C; 2.5 hrs for full charge; 15 min = up to 2.5 hrs play | USB-C (Fast Charge: 15 min = 7 hours playback) |
Multipoint | Yes (2 devices with seamless switching) | Yes (Connect two devices simultaneously) |
Low Latency Mode | No (SimpleSync available only for Bose Soundbars) | Yes (via aptX Adaptive automatically) |
Wired Mode | Yes (Active or Passive - passive sounds different) | Yes (USB-C and 3.5 mm supported; Audio playback only – microphone does not work in wired mode) |
Water Resistance | None | No (No IP rating) |
Weight | 238 g | 320 g (11.3 oz) |
Controls | Physical buttons (Volume, Play/Pause, Mode Switch) | Physical buttons (Play/Pause, Vol +/-, ANC toggle, Power/Slider) |
App Eq | Bose Music app (3-band EQ + Presets) | Bowers & Wilkins Music App (Bass/Treble tone controls only; no graphic EQ) |
Extras | Wind Block feature; Spotify Tap; Foldable design; Hard carry case included | Wear-Detection Sensor; Nappa Leather & Cast Aluminum arms; Included hard shell carrying case |
